How to remove stretch marks
Stretchmarks (or striae as they are referred to in dermatological terms) are caused when your skin is stretched a lot over a short period of time : more precisely, the skin’s second layer is torn rather than stretched. The worst affected places are the stomach, breasts, thighs and hips. Both women and men can suffer from them and they affect most of people. Fortunately, our health is not affected by them and only affect us cosmetically. However, As it becomes warmer, and we wear fewer clothes, our concerns about stretch marks increase.
How do stretchmarks occur?
This Stretching happens when the body grows at a high rate so that the skin can’t stretch quick enough to keep up with it. Stretch marks are most commonly associated with pregnancy however, they also develop during puberty: sudden weight gain and even body building can also result in stretch marks.
Although the skin is usually fairly elastic , when it is overstretched, the normal production of collagen is disrupted. It is this collagen which helps to keep skin tight and supple. There are several external factors which affect the ability of the skin to produce and maintain collagen levels such as diet or smoking These collagen levels affect the appearance of facial wrinkles and lines. They also influence how other blemishes, like surgery scars and acne scars, heal.
What do stretch marks look like?
When they first form, stretch marks appear as reddish purple lines. They appear indented and maintain a different texture to the surrounding skin. as they get older, the deep colour fades, turning a silvery colour. The ability to heal however does vary considerably from individual to individual.
Remove stretchmarks
Stretch marks removal can be done in several different ways. Stretch mark treatments Come in all sorts of varieties of price, procedure and effectiveness, treatments range from creams to cosmetic surgery for most people, stretch marks are ugly and undesirable and often make people feel self concious, but this can be overcome or prevented by treatment to remove stretch marks.
Creams and oils are the cheapest way to treat stretch marks however, not all creams work overall, creams are not the best stretch marks treatment. Using creams with techniques such as micro-needling, allows significantly more cream to be absorbed so this method often proves the best method for many individuals.
